Scottish techno label Soma Recordings has done some crate digging close to home and found a Daft Punk track lost since 1994.
Soma celebrates its 20th anniversary this year and has been rummaging through the vaults to put together a compilation to mark the occasion and look back at such successes as putting out early releases by the French house duo.
